About the job:

The Regional Account Manager (RAM) position is within our Rare Hematology and Nephrology Franchise, a division of Alexion, AstraZeneca Rare Disease and will focus on the launch of IgAN as a potential new indication. The RAM will be assigned a sales territory focused on academic centers, community hospital systems, physician clinics, infusion centers, and other strategic sites of care, focused on nephrology. This individual would be responsible for the growth and expansion of the IgAN indication while supporting appropriate assigned indication opportunities with key nephrology customers.

What You’ll Do
As a Regional Account Manager – Rare Nephrology, you’ll build trusted relationships with healthcare professionals across your territory. You’ll represent Alexion’s nephrology indications, helping providers understand our therapies and how they support patients with rare nephrological conditions.
Territory Includes: Detroit, Dearborn, Ann Arbor, Livonia, MI. Must live within the geography.

You will:

  • Consistently achieve or exceed sales objectives in assigned territory

  • Create and maintain strategically targeted account-specific business plans that reflect an in-depth understanding of local market forces impacting product sales, diagnostic pathways, referral patterns, and treatment adoption.

  • Develop and maintain strong, in-depth clinical, technical, and scientific knowledge across assigned indications, with emphasis on renal disease education and the needs of nephrology customers.

  • Demonstrate the ability to educate on the clinical approach to relevant disease states, leading to successful differential diagnosis, appropriate testing, and timely treatment of focus patient populations.

  • Build and maintain productive relationships with nephrologists and other key stakeholders in academic centers, community hospital systems, physician clinics, infusion centers, and related sites of care.

  • Collaborate closely with internal cross-functional stakeholders, including peer RAM(s), TLL(s), SAL(s), MSL(s), FRM(s), PEM(s), Market Access, Diagnostics, and enterprise partners.

  • Handle customer questions and objections in a way that is consistent with product indications and sales training methodology, including the ability to compliantly triage inquiries to the appropriate partner.

  • Understand and demonstrate proper use of products to clinicians in hospital, clinic, and infusion center environments.

  • Lead the implementation of a patient-centric partnership model that includes physicians, their staff, patients, clinics, hospitals, and relevant care partners.

  • Effectively utilize CRM tools to manage territory priorities, track account engagement, document sales activities, and submit required reports accurately and on time; and adopt CRM AI-embedded tools to prioritize opportunities and optimize call execution

  • Effectively use AI-driven insights for territory planning, HCP targeting, and pre-call strategy; translate analytics into focused customer engagement and account action plans

  • Execute local promotional activities and programs for the assigned therapeutic areas.

  • Provide a high level of product expertise and customer service to all accounts.

  • Proactively interact with Alexion management to refine product and market initiatives based on field insights, access trends, and account needs.

  • Perform work in alignment with and adhering to Alexion’s Code of Ethics and Business Conduct and Alexion policies and procedures.
